Описание: Molecular electronic-structure theory uses quantum mechanics to calculate the energies and wave functions of molecules and their molecular properties. It uses sophisticated mathematics and computers to solved the wave equations. The calculations can be used to find out how the atoms of the molecule are linked together in a molecule.
